Since its founding in 1969, Community Action House has been the focal point of community efforts to provide critical support and pathways out of poverty for our neighbors in need. Our community-powered work takes a client-centric approach that meets people wherever they are at and offers services that enhance ownership and agency. Our work is organized in three interconnected areas: Food Access, Resource Navigation, and Financial Wellness. Welcome, excellence, and collaboration are some of our core values. In October 2021, we launched our new ‘Food Club & Opportunity Hub’ to expand efficient, impactful healthy food assistance with the on-site integration of other pathway programs. More recently, we announced a partnership with Dwelling Place to help address the affordable housing crisis here in Holland. In July 2023, we publicly launched our expansion of Lakeshore Food Rescue (www.lakeshorefoodrescue.org).
Organizational budget: $9M-10M (inclusive of $5M in-kind support)
Agency Size: 60-70 staff and 2,300+ annual volunteers

Summary
The Communications Intern supports key storytelling and outreach efforts that help advance Community Action House’s mission and connect with our broader community. This role involves drafting various forms of content, while helping maintain a consistent voice and visual identity across platforms. The Communications Intern will assist in planning communications around the Resale Store launch, contribute to content calendar development, and support the creation of on-brand graphics and campaign materials. This position offers hands-on experience in nonprofit communications and works closely with the Communications Team to build awareness and engagement.
